NASCAR Takes Two Cars, Four Engines To R&D Center

Joe Gibbs Racing’s No. 11 Toyota Camry and Hendrick Motorsports’ No. 48 Chevy Impala failed to pass the height sticks on the first attempt during post-race inspection. After the shocks cooled down, both cars passed, but NASCAR took pictures of the cars before they passed.

Richard Childress Racing’s No. 33 Chevy Impala and Roush Fenway Racing’s No. 6 Ford Fusion were taken to the research and development center in North Carolina for further analysis.

NASCAR also took engines from RCR’s No. 33, JRG’s No. 11, RFR’s No. 6, and Whitney Motorsports’ No. 46 Dodge.
